Rival, laborious, or eager
Emelynn is a modern elaboration of the name Emily or the medieval Germanic name Emeline. It likely derives from the Roman family name Aemilius, meaning 'rival,' or the Germanic element 'amal,' meaning 'work' or 'labor.'
Less common today
Emelynn isn't in the latest US Top 1000. It last peaked at #6,395 in 2019.
